Output 8317e8fbd120e86b8ba9ed926799da878b996650c246428858f956d38562c105:0

value
10033609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d3cb692d195fbdf60c4c79fb6da5ad006741344 OP_EQUAL
address
32u1STp74eCJW6bsmeweNHuFpSG81zye1H
transaction
8317e8fbd120e86b8ba9ed926799da878b996650c246428858f956d38562c105
spent
true